The Ultimate Guide to RTMP Server Ubuntu: Advantages, Disadvantages, and FAQ

Introduction

Welcome to the ultimate guide to RTMP Server Ubuntu. Today, we are going to discuss everything you need to know about RTMP Server Ubuntu, its advantages, disadvantages, frequently asked questions, and much more. If you are a video content creator or want to stream live video content on your website, RTMP Server Ubuntu is what you need. In this article, we will explain what RTMP Server Ubuntu is, how it works, and its benefits and drawbacks.

What is RTMP Server Ubuntu?

RTMP Server Ubuntu is an open-source, high-performance streaming media server that can stream live video and audio content to remote clients over the internet. Unlike traditional video-sharing platforms like YouTube and Vimeo, RTMP Server Ubuntu allows for real-time video streaming.

It can be used to stream video content for various purposes, such as online gaming, live music events, webinars, and much more. RTMP Server Ubuntu is compatible with various video streaming protocols like RTSP, RTMPS, and HTTP, making it easier to stream video content on various devices and platforms.

How does RTMP Server Ubuntu work?

RTMP Server Ubuntu works by establishing a real-time connection between the server and the client. The client sends a request to the server for a particular video stream, and the server sends the requested video stream in real-time to the client. This way, the client can view the video content in real-time with minimal latency.

RTMP Server Ubuntu makes use of the Real-Time Messaging Protocol (RTMP) to communicate with the clients. RTMP is a protocol used to stream audio, video, and data between a server and a client. RTMP Server Ubuntu allows developers to stream video content from various sources, such as webcams, cameras, and other multimedia devices.

Advantages of RTMP Server Ubuntu

RTMP Server Ubuntu has various advantages that make it a popular choice for video content creators. Some of the advantages of RTMP Server Ubuntu are:

1. High-quality video and audio streaming

RTMP Server Ubuntu provides high-quality audio and video streaming to clients in real-time. It uses advanced compression techniques to reduce the size of the video stream without compromising the quality of the video.

2. Low latency

RTMP Server Ubuntu provides low latency video streaming by establishing a direct connection between the server and the client. This way, the video stream is delivered to the client in real-time without any significant delay.

3. Multiple platform compatibility

RTMP Server Ubuntu is compatible with multiple platforms and devices, making it easy to stream video content across different devices. It supports various protocols like RTSP, RTMPS, and HTTP, making it easier to stream video content on various platforms.

4. Customizable

RTMP Server Ubuntu is highly customizable, allowing developers to tailor the server to meet their specific needs. Developers can customize the server’s settings to optimize the video streaming performance and enhance user experience.

5. Open-source

RTMP Server Ubuntu is an open-source software, making it available to everyone for free. Developers can use the software to create their video streaming platforms without incurring any licensing fees.

Disadvantages of RTMP Server Ubuntu

While RTMP Server Ubuntu has various advantages, it also has some drawbacks that need to be considered. Some of the disadvantages of RTMP Server Ubuntu are:

1. Requires technical knowledge

RTMP Server Ubuntu requires technical knowledge to install and set up the server correctly. Developers need to have a good understanding of server administration and networking to configure the server correctly.

2. Limited support

RTMP Server Ubuntu has a limited support community, making it difficult to obtain support when needed. Developers may need to hire a consultant to help them solve any issues they may encounter while using the server.

READ ALSO  Ubuntu 16.04 Email Server: A Comprehensive Guide

3. Not suitable for large-scale streaming

RTMP Server Ubuntu is not suitable for large-scale streaming as it can only handle a limited number of clients. If you plan to stream video content to a large audience, you may need to consider other streaming solutions.

4. Configuration issues

RTMP Server Ubuntu has several configuration issues that need to be considered. Developers need to configure the server correctly to maximize its performance and user experience.

RTMP Server Ubuntu: Complete Information Table

Name
RTMP Server Ubuntu
Type
Media streaming server
Compatible protocols
RTMP, RTSP, RTMPS, HTTP
Open-source
Yes
Platform compatibility
Linux, Ubuntu
Video and audio quality
High
Latency
Low
Customizable
Yes
Support community
Small
Scalability
Low

FAQs

1. What is RTMP Server Ubuntu?

RTMP Server Ubuntu is an open-source media streaming server that allows developers to stream video and audio content to clients over the internet.

2. What protocols does RTMP Server Ubuntu support?

RTMP Server Ubuntu supports various protocols like RTMP, RTSP, RTMPS, and HTTP.

3. Is RTMP Server Ubuntu free?

Yes, RTMP Server Ubuntu is an open-source software available to everyone for free.

4. Is RTMP Server Ubuntu customizable?

Yes, RTMP Server Ubuntu is highly customizable, allowing developers to tailor the server to meet their specific needs.

5. Does RTMP Server Ubuntu require technical knowledge to set up?

Yes, RTMP Server Ubuntu requires technical knowledge to install and set up the server correctly.

6. Can RTMP Server Ubuntu handle large-scale streaming?

No, RTMP Server Ubuntu is not suitable for large-scale streaming as it can only handle a limited number of clients.

7. What is the latency of RTMP Server Ubuntu?

RTMP Server Ubuntu provides low latency video streaming by establishing a direct connection between the server and the client.

8. Is RTMP Server Ubuntu compatible with Linux?

Yes, RTMP Server Ubuntu is compatible with Linux.

9. What is the support community for RTMP Server Ubuntu?

RTMP Server Ubuntu has a small support community, making it difficult to obtain support when needed.

10. Does RTMP Server Ubuntu have any configuration issues?

Yes, RTMP Server Ubuntu has several configuration issues that need to be considered.

11. What is the advantage of using RTMP Server Ubuntu?

RTMP Server Ubuntu provides high-quality video and audio streaming in real-time with low latency.

12. What is the disadvantage of using RTMP Server Ubuntu?

RTMP Server Ubuntu requires technical knowledge to set up, has limited support, and is not suitable for large-scale streaming.

13. Can RTMP Server Ubuntu stream video content from various sources?

Yes, RTMP Server Ubuntu can stream video content from various sources, such as webcams, cameras, and other multimedia devices.

Conclusion

RTMP Server Ubuntu is a powerful and versatile media streaming server that provides high-quality audio and video streaming in real-time. It is an open-source software that is highly customizable and compatible with various platforms and protocols. While RTMP Server Ubuntu has some disadvantages, its advantages make it a popular choice for video content creators worldwide. We strongly encourage you to consider RTMP Server Ubuntu for your media streaming needs.

Closing or Disclaimer

The information presented here is intended to provide general information on RTMP Server Ubuntu. While we have made every effort to ensure the accuracy of the information provided, we cannot guarantee that it is entirely accurate or up-to-date. We strongly recommend that you seek professional advice before implementing any information or suggestions provided here. We will not be responsible for any loss or damages that may arise from the use of the information presented in this article.

READ ALSO  Auto Start VNC Server Ubuntu 14.04: Everything You Need to Know

Video:The Ultimate Guide to RTMP Server Ubuntu: Advantages, Disadvantages, and FAQ